Angelina Jolie Has Filed For Divorce From Brad Pitt

The actress cited "irreconcilable differences."

Angelina Jolie has filed for divorce from Brad Pitt, citing irreconcilable differences, according to court documents obtained by BuzzFeed News on Tuesday.

The couple, who officially married in 2014, have six children together.

Citing irreconcilable differences, Jolie is seeking full physical custody of all of the children, according to the court documents filed in Los Angeles County Superior Court. She is also asking that Pitt be granted joint legal custody and visitation rights.

According to TMZ, which first reported the news, Jolie was upset with Pitt's parenting "methods."

"This decision was made for the health of the family. She will not be commenting, and asks that the family be given its privacy at this time," Jolie's attorney, Robert Offer, said in the statement to Reuters.

Pitt asked for privacy in a statement to People, saying he is most concerned with protecting his children.

"I am very saddened by this, but what matters most now is the well being of our kids," he said. "I kindly ask the press to give them the space they deserve during this challenging time."

The superstar couple were famously first linked in 2004, when they co-starred in Mr. & Mrs. Smith. Pitt was still married to Jennifer Aniston at the time.

At the time, tabloids noted their "growing intimacy" but Pitt and Jolie denied a romance, Entertainment Weekly had reported.

Shortly after, in January 2005, Pitt and Aniston announced they were divorcing.

Pitt was soon spotted spending time with Jolie and her young son Maddox. In 2006, the couple announced they were expecting, and daughter Shiloh was born in May.

The couple are also parents to daughter Zahara, son Pax, and twins Vivienne and Knox.
